Understanding Advanced Irrigation Technologies
As agricultural needs raise, recognizing sophisticated irrigation innovations becomes important for optimizing water use and enhancing crop yields. These modern technologies include various systems developed to deliver water efficiently to plants, making certain that they receive the necessary dampness without wastage. Amongst these systems are drip irrigation, lawn sprinkler, and subsurface watering, each customized to certain farming demands and environments.
Drip watering, as an example, includes the sluggish release of water directly to the plant roots, lessening dissipation and overflow. This technique not just saves water however likewise promotes healthier plant growth. Similarly, automatic sprinkler are adaptable, offering protection throughout diverse terrains. Subsurface irrigation, hidden underground, decreases water loss appreciably.
Integrating automation and sensing unit innovation even more enhances these systems, allowing real-time surveillance and changes based on soil moisture levels and weather problems. Inevitably, an extensive understanding of these advanced watering modern technologies is crucial for lasting agricultural practices.
Advantages of Drip Irrigation Equipments
Leak irrigation systems offer numerous benefits that make them a recommended choice amongst modern-day agricultural practices. These systems supply water directly to the plant origins, making sure efficient usage of water resources. By decreasing evaporation and drainage, they significantly lower water waste, contributing to lasting farming.
Additionally, drip watering permits exact control over water application, enabling farmers to tailor watering schedules based on details crop demands. This targeted method can lead to much healthier plants, minimized weed growth, and lower plant food use, ultimately enhancing dirt wellness.
The installation of drip systems can also lead to labor cost savings, as they commonly need less hand-operated treatment compared to traditional irrigation approaches. Moreover, the regular wetness offered by drip irrigation can boost plant high quality and yield. Overall, these advantages placement drip irrigation as an important part in the pursuit for much more effective and efficient agricultural practices.
The Effect of Precision Irrigation on Crop Yields
While standard watering approaches commonly bring about irregular water circulation, accuracy irrigation technologies have actually changed plant administration by enhancing water application based on real-time information. This technique enables farmers to deliver the specific quantity of water needed for particular plants, thereby reducing waste and enhancing plant health. By employing sensors and automated systems, accuracy watering guarantees that water is used at the best time and in the appropriate quantities, resulting in improved dirt wetness levels.
Research study has shown that plants watered using accuracy techniques can experience considerable return increases compared to those under standard methods. The targeted application reduces water stress during critical growth stages, promoting stronger root advancement and much better nutrient uptake.
